When a tooth becomes infected, treatment is necessary. Lack of treatment means the tooth could become necrotic. At this stage, the tooth might require extraction. Otherwise, the infection moves into surrounding teeth. Often, a better treatment for an infected tooth is root canal therapy. This procedure is effective, but sometimes a root canalled tooth becomes infected again, and retreatment could be needed. You may need to book an online appointment with one of our knowledgeable Chignik Lake dentists for a root canal redo.


Root canal treatment involves removing the tissues from inside of the tooth. The interiors and root canals are thoroughly cleaned, and a restorative material known as gutta percha is then applied to the interior. Usually, the tooth is then capped with a full restoration. The restoration is often custom-made to protect the tooth and also match the rest of the smile. But if there are complications with the procedure, the health of the tooth could be compromised. The tooth could begin developing symptoms, such as toothaches and complications with eating. If you experience this, don’t risk tooth loss. A dental abscess means that harmful bacteria have made contact with interior nerve tissues. The pulp is the nerve center of the tooth, and it ensures a functional tooth. Lack of intervention for an infection could allow symptoms to grow worse. A common warning sign of trouble could include pain when eating. Don’t ignore a potential symptom. Talk to our team about finding a Chignik Lake endodontist who accepts Blue Cross Blue Shield and other dental insurance plans.


A root canal procedure is a restorative dental treatment that can be completed in one sitting. Essentially, after the dentist examines the tooth, the carious tooth structures are removed from within. The interior of the tooth is cleaned, and a special restorative material is added. The last step involves capping the tooth with a porcelain or metal crown. The cap is designed to protect the tooth and appear esthetically pleasing. This treatment stops the spread of infection.


Daily brushing and flossing can help lower your risk of future caries and dental infections. Routine six-month visits help as well. In addition to offering biannual dental checkups and cleanings, dentists on Doctors Network also provide your kids with protective sealants. These are thin pieces of film that go over their molars. They work as a protective film that forms a shield between their adult molars and germs. This ultimately prevents the risk of cavities by up to 80%. It is a simple tool that is very effective at preventing cavities on adult teeth in the future.


Fluoride treatments are another great tool that your pediatric dental professionals provide. Fluoride is a natural mineral that helps strengthen your child’s enamel layer. While enamel is one of the most durable substances our bodies produce, it can still weaken over time. When this occurs, your child’s teeth become more susceptible to cavities. This procedure helps mitigate this damage. Using high-fluoride toothpaste can also help. When you visit your Chignik Lake dental practice, they can provide you with either an in-office or even at-home treatment option. Should you opt for treatment in the office, you will only have to stay for roughly an hour. When you come in, your dentist will apply a bleaching gel to your front teeth that is then activated with a specialized light that removes discoloration.

If you would prefer to go with whitening at home, your dentist will give you a set of custom trays that you can fill with a safe peroxide solution. You will wear these for one or two hours each day for about 2 weeks. Once this treatment is over, you will have a brighter smile.
